Format: http://dep.debian.net/deps/dep5/
Upstream-Name: Catalyst-Engine-PSGI
Upstream-Contact: Tatsuhiko Miyagawa <miyagawa@bulknews.net>
Source: http://search.cpan.org/dist/Catalyst-Engine-PSGI/
Comment: The upstream sources were repackaged in order to remove
 the t/catalyst directory due to missing license/copyright, and the
 images under t/Hello/root/ since not in preferred form for making
 modifications.
 .
 The +dfsg tarball can be created using the repack.sh script (via
 repack.stub) and is automatically run on upgrade by uscan.
